-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
文档名称:需求分析
项目名称:商品管理系统
项目责任人:xxxx
项目组长:xxx
程序录入:xxxxx
需求分析:xxxxxx
软件测试: xxxx
开发单位:xxx
引言
1.1编写目标
为了开发出真正满足用户需求软件产品,首先必需知道用户需求,确定用户所需软件产品功效,对软件需求深入需求是软件产品开发工作取得成功前提条件,不管我们把设计和编码工作做得怎样出色,不能真正满足用户需求程序只会令用户失望,给开发者带来麻烦。
需求分析是软件定义时期最终一个阶段,它基础任务是正确回复“系统必需做什么?”这个问题。它确定系统必需完成哪些工作,对目标系统提出完整、正确、清楚、具体要求。用户真正知道自己需要什么后,将其正确、具体描述出来,分析者再得出用软件实现她们需求方案。
购物已成为生活中不可缺乏一部分,大大小小商店,超市充斥着城市乡镇每个角落,一套优异商品管理系统对于商家管理者和消费者全部会起到很关键作用,不仅便于消费者对商品信息进行查询,也便于商家对所拥有产品信息进行更新,修改,管理,所以有必需设计一套管理系统对商品进行管理。
1.2项目背景
本系统管理任务是要取得用户对整个商品管理系统具体需求情况所得,系统初步确定关键由系统登陆界面,主窗体和设计窗体组成。关键供用户管理大量商品,而且能对商品基础资料有效立即查阅和修改操作。在本系统中,基于管理员和用户权限作了明确安全系统保护。在设计窗体中能一打开查阅窗体目录,对主窗体情况一目了然,也能在另一方窗体中查阅生成报表。在主窗体中,能实施增加、删除、修改、查询数据操作。
1.3定义
软件需求分析是由软件开发方在系统需求分析基础上,依据交办方提出软件任务书和其它文件进行。承接方要具体确定软件需求并制订出一个需求完整、具体,又含有很好使用性软件需求规格说明书。
承接方必需写出具体软件需求规格说明书和其它文档,并进行需求逐步审查,最终作为整个开发工作基础。
软件项目组组建和计划工作也是本阶段关键任务。
2. 任务概述
2.1 目标
完成功效需求分析、性能需求分析、界面需求分析,其中包含用visio完成需求分析中DFD(数据流图)和DD(数据字典)画法,和E_R图。
2.2 运行环境
用户机:外围设备:鼠标,键盘,显示器;
操作系统:装有浏览器多种操作系统;
服务器:外围设备:鼠标,键盘,显示器;
编译程序:VB 6.0;
操作系统: windows操作系统;
数据库支持:SQL Server ;
数据存放能力和测试支持能力:需要有较高系统支持。
2.3技术要求
软件需求分析阶段技术要求以下:
(1)软件需求规格要说明对应软件关键功效、性能、技术指标进行定义,其内容应全方面、可检验。
(2)项目开发计划中应给出阶段评审和配置管理计划,并明确人员。
(3)软件需求规格说明书要正确而合适地定义软件功效、性能等全部软件需求,无须描述设计和管理细节。
(4)要求编制软件需求规格要含有:完整性、明确性、一致性、可验证性及可测试性、易修改、包含软件需要关键功效、软件可追踪、需求基于运行环境、描述软件应发生事件和不应发生事件。
3. 数据描述
3.1 静态数据
在软件开发过程中不可改变数据,包含会员和管理员账号注册时间,地址,性别,还有商品商品名称,商品类别。
3.2 动态数据
在软件开发过程中能够改变数据,除开静态数据以外数据。
3.3 E-R图
为了把用户数据要求清楚、正确地描述出来,就需要建立一个面向问题数据模型,是用户见解对数据建立模型,常见实体-联络图(E-R图)来描述,该模型包含三种相互关联信息:数据对象、数据对象属性及数据对象相互间相互连接关系。
3.4 数据流图(DFD)
当数据在软件系统中移动时,它将被部分“变换”所修改。数据流图(DFD)是一个图形化技术,它描绘信息流和数据从输入到输出过程中所经受变换。在数据流图中没有任何物理部件,它只描绘数据在软件中流动和被处理逻辑过程,它是分析员和用户间几号通信工具。另外,设计数据流图时只需要考虑系统必需完成基础逻辑功效,不需要考虑怎样具体实现这些功效。
数据流图中有四种基础符号:正方形表示数据原点或终点;圆形代表数据处理;两条平行横线代表数据存放;箭头表示数据流,即特定数据流动方向。数据流图基础关键点是描绘“做什么”,而不考虑“真么做”。
数据流图以下:
3.5 数据字典(DD)
数据字典是相关数据信息集合,也就是数据流图中包含全部元素定义集合,它作用是在软件分析和设计过程中给人提供相关数据描述信息。
数据流图和数据字典共同组成系统逻辑模型,没有数据字典数据流图就不严格;没有数据流图,数据字典也难以发挥作用。
数据字典有下列四类元素定义组成:
(1)数据流
您可能关注的文档
最近下载
- DGTJ08-1202-2024建设工程造价咨询标准.pdf VIP
- 交流变频调速技术6.ppt VIP
- 安全生产方针、目标.docx VIP
- 赫达工业纤维素醚产品手册.pdf VIP
- 2024年浙江省中医院招聘笔试参考题库含答案详解.pdf
- 多模态大模型关键技术的研究与应用.docx VIP
- 教师工作总结教师工作总结.docx VIP
- 上海市2025年六年级上册地理期末考试带参考答案与解析.pdf VIP
- DB31∕T 1551-2025 企业集团安全生产管控基本规范.pdf
- (2025年领导班子围绕带头强化政治忠诚、提高政治能力方面;带头固本培元、增强党性方面;带头敬畏人民、敬畏组织、敬畏法纪方面;带头干事创业、担当作为方面;带头坚决扛起管党治党责任方面)民主生活会“五个带头”对照检查.docx VIP
原创力文档


文档评论(0)